The importance of description and setting -- Learning to pay attention -- Using all the tools in your kit -- Showing, telling, and combining the two -- Sensory description -- Description of characters -- Time and place -- Description and setting in specialized fiction -- Using description and setting to drive the story -- Working the magic -- Too little, too much -- Description and setting in the writing process.
"With dozens of excerpts from some of today's most popular writers, Write Great Fiction: Description & Setting gives you all the information you need to create a sharp and believable world of people, places, events, and actions."--BOOK JACKET.
